
Gymnastics Season Tickets on Sale Now
August 01, 2018 | Women's Gymnastics
CORVALLIS, Ore. – Season tickets for the 2018-19 Oregon State gymnastics season are now available for sale.
Â
Reserved season tickets are available for $60. OSU faculty and staff as well as senior citizens (aged 62 and up) can purchase reserved season tickets for $48 with a limit of two seats per person. Adult general admission tickets are available for $35, while senior/youth (ages 3-18) general admission is $25.
Â
Seat locations can be secured by visiting BeaverTickets.com/Gymnastics, by calling 1-800-GO-BEAVS or in person at the OSU Ticket Office in Gill Coliseum. Ticket office hours are 9 a.m. to 5 p.m.
Â
Oregon State is slated to host five meets beginning in January 2019 and the full schedule will be released in the fall.
Â
The Beavers return 15 letterwinners and 22 out of 24 routines from the 2018 squad. Four seniors – Mariana Colussi-Pelaez, Lacy Dagen, Mary Jacobsen and McKenna Singley – are expected to lead the Orange and Black as they seek a return trip to the NCAA postseason for the 45th straight season. Among the other returners will be Kaitlyn Yanish, who earned All-America honors as a freshman.
